rvd's mic skills really lack while carlito's are pretty good. rvd is great but he is just to mellow, and doesnt seem to have the depth as a character like carlito does. it just seems like carlito should be fighting for the IC belt rather than the wigger belt right now.

RVD cut great promos in ECW when he was just thrown in front of a camera and could pretty much say whatever he wanted to. The guy was an arrgoant prick and people loved him because of that.

The problem with him now is pretty common to a lot of WWE guys and has derailed a lot of careers.

WWE has a team of writers who basically write scripts out for these guys and have them memorize it word for word. Add to it the fact that many of the writers have no background in wrestling and guys get promos that don't fit their personality, come across as stupid, or just flat out don't work.

Back when Russo was the head writer, he would just give guys a basic direction he wanted the promo to go in and the wrestlers were pretty much free to do what they want within that framework. Look at all the stars who struggled earlier in their careers who blew up once they were given more control over their characters; Austin, Rock, Mankind, DX including Triple H.

And in Heyman's ECW, he bascially just put the matches together and guys could do whatever they wanted in their promos. And more stars came out of/through ECW in the 90s than pretty much anywhere else.

The way WWE does business hurts a lot of these guys.
